Abstract

The present invention relates to a TIG welding torch, and the TIG welding torch, according to the present invention, comprises: a torch handle provided with an operation switch; a coupling frame rotatably coupled to a coupling part curvedly formed at a predetermined position of the outer side of the torch handle; and a welding head coupled to the coupling frame so as to enable vertical movement, wherein a pair of support parts extending so as to be parallel with the welding head are protrudingly formed on an end portion of the coupling frame.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of GTAW torch, specifically, in the welding process of li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) thin web, this GTAW torch can form consistent gap and consistent solder joint between thin web.
Background technology
In general, li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) is the oil carrier of high added value, is designed to conveying liquified natural gas at sea.Li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) according to the type of containment system, can be divided into self supporting type and diaphragm type.Self supporting type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) is made up of the hull of mutual independently storage tank, storage tank bracing frame and waterproof.Self supporting type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) has two kinds usually, MOSS type and SPB type.Cargo hold on diaphragm type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) by directly a kind of heat sink material formation of application on hull, and can be divided into GT type and TGZ type.Owing to comparing self supporting type, film-type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) cost is relatively low, and windward side is large under sail, and lee face hour, more easily carries out Change In Design.Film-type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) is assessed as and has outstanding mobility and navigation performance.When film-type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) is made up of bilayer film plate, can effectively alleviates own wt and improve intensity.Film-type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) has a double-decker, and thermal insulation board is as second class protection layer wherein, and the film be made up of thin metal material is attached on the inner surface of containment system as elementary protective layer and forms bilayer.
A kind of method constructing diaphragm type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) film; comprise thin web 10 and 10 ' overlapping placement; then by a manual 1, solder joint 11 is welded in distance thin web regulated between thin web with consistent interval, finally carries out the main welding processes such as such as automatic plasma welding as shown in Figure 1 or manual gas tungsten arc welding.
But as GTT (France) companies ask developing film-type li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) the earliest, in the welding of laboratory, the gap of two pieces of thin web formation should be strict controlled in below 0.3mm.This is the defect in order to reduce in automatic plasma welding or tungsten electrode Shielding gas process.If the excesssive gap between thin web, weld seam can not be formed smoothly at gap location, thus easily form weld defect.For this reason, the gap between thin web will be reduced to minimum by hammer.In order to keep the gap between thin web constant, need to use gas tungsten arc welding machine to carry out spot welding on one piece or similar point, but be difficult to accurately control.
In addition, because the size of the solder joint of spot welding does not specify especially, result in a problem, welding quality depends on the weld horizontal of welder.In other words, the reduction of quality of welding spot may cause weld defect, in other words because solder joint is excessive or too small, in the main welding process after weld defect also may appear at.
That is, in the welding process of film-type liquefied natural gas thin web, the gap between thin web and the state of solder joint depend on the qualification of workman.The quality of solder joint state has a great impact follow-up main welding process, and this also will cause producing weld defect.

Fig. 2 be according to one embodiment of present invention in the side sectional view of GTAW torch.Fig. 3 is the decomposition diagram of the coupling shelf in Fig. 2.Fig. 4 is the sectional view of the welding gun moving process in Fig. 2.
As Fig. 2 to Fig. 4; GTAW torch 100 in one embodiment of the present of invention is used in the welding process of liquified natural gas carrier (LNGC) film; wherein multiple thin web for the manufacture of film overlaps each other, and solder joint is distributed between thin web along the lap of thin web with consistent spacing.This GTAW torch 100 comprises welding handle 110, coupling shelf 120 and welding gun 140.
This torch handle 110 is parts that in welding process, welder is hand-held, is provided with a console switch 112 at the assigned address of torch handle 110 outer surface.In addition, torch handle 110 comprises the power line and inner space 114 that provide electric energy.Inner space 114 is provided with air shooter, and air shooter can provide inert gas with flexible pipe or copper pipe to welding gun 140.
Coupling unit 116 is bent to form at the assigned address of the outer surface of torch handle 110, and coupling shelf 120 rotates and is coupled on this coupling unit 116, and is hereafter describing in detail.
In addition, support wheel 118 to be coupled on this coupling unit 116, and support wheel 118 supports this welding torch 100 against thin web (10,10 '), and this welding torch 100 can be moved along the lap between thin web easily.
Preferably, support wheel 118 is coupled on the elongated hole 116a of coupling shelf 116, and in this case, support wheel 118 can slide along the short transverse of coupling shelf 116.
And, torch handle 110 wherein also comprise an assist handle 119, operator can one be held by torch handle 110, another is held by assist handle 119, like this, this welding torch 100 of the operation that operator can be stable.
Coupling shelf 120 rotates and is coupled on the coupling unit 116 that is bent to form on torch handle 110, so that welding gun 140 can be coupled on this coupling shelf 120 in the mode of vertically movement, and is hereafter describing in detail.
Coupling shelf 120 comprises a pair side rack 122, each side rack 122 comprises on the fastener hole 116b that fastening bolt 122a is secured in coupling unit 116 both side surface, the upper and lower that upper bracket 124 and lower carriage 126 are coupled to this side rack 122 respectively to be interconnected with side rack, upper bracket 124 and lower carriage 126 are respectively equipped with upper and lower opening (124a, 126a) so that welding gun 140 is inserted by this opening.The coupling element 128 being separated from each other into two pieces for a pair is coupled to the outer surface of welding gun 140, and is coupled on side rack 122 simultaneously, inserts and arrange a pair connection strap 129 between upper bracket 124 and side rack 122.
Further, pair of supporting 127, from the bottom of coupling shelf 120, is such as given prominence to downwards from lower carriage 126, and extends to the position arranged side by side with welding gun 140, and this part will be described below.When burn-oning solder joint 11 with consistent spacing at the lap of thin web, bracing frame 127 just can make to remain a gap between welding gun 140 and the lap of thin web.
Have a gathering sill 122b at the inner surface of each side rack, the outer surface of each coupling element 128 is provided with a protruding gib block 128a, can insert this gathering sill 122b in the mode be slidably connected.Thus, the welding gun 140 being coupled to this coupling element 128 can slide along coupling shelf 120 short transverse.
And, rotating shaft 130 is connected on any one coupling element 128 through the through hole 129a spiral on connection strap 129, and, connection strap 129 is also provided with a clamping element 129b with through hole 129a, after through hole is inserted in rotating shaft 130, the outer surface of clamping element 129b clamping shaft.
In this case, preferably, rotating shaft 130 assigned address is provided with a holddown groove 130a along shaft length direction, is used for one end of coupling clamping element 129b.
As Fig. 4, the slip of coupling element 128 is realized by the rotation of rotating shaft 130 at different directions, can describe in detail hereinafter.
First, when one end of rotating shaft 130 is close to lower carriage 126, rotating shaft 130 in a clockwise direction, coupling element 128 slides towards upper bracket 124.
On the contrary, when coupling element 128 slides towards lower carriage 126, when the holddown groove 130a above the rotating shaft 130 and clamping element 129b on connection strap 129 is in same straight line, rotates clamping element 129b and be fixed groove 130a.After this, rotating shaft 130 is counterclockwise to rotate, and coupling element 128 will slide towards lower carriage 126.
In other words, coupling element 128 can carry out bracket slide up and down according to the rotation direction of rotating shaft 130, so that the welding gun 140 being coupled to coupling element 128 also can carry out descending operation along coupling shelf 120 short transverse.
Welding gun 140 is used to burn-on solder joint with consistent spacing between thin web intersection, and welding gun is coupled on coupling shelf 120 in a kind of mode of vertical movement by coupling element 128.Welding gun 140 is widely known by the people in place of the present invention technical field, so detailed this omission that is described in of Butt welding gun repeats no more.
